The bank holiday weekend of the 24th -26th of May saw the Gloucestershire Warwickshire Railway hold their annual Cotswold Festival of Steam, with no less than six guest locomotives in attendance, along with five of its resident fleet, bringing the operational fleet to eleven locos. During the event, the private station grounds of Gotherington Halt were opened to the public specially courtesy of the owners, with opportunities to ride the pump trolley in the yard. The event would also be the final gala appearance of resident Bulleid Merchant Navy class 35006 Peninsular & Oriental S. N. Co. before withdrawal later in the year for overhaul. The services of the event had four passenger carriage sets consisting of two five coach and two seven coach sets, plus a demonstration freight train running the full length of the line. There was also a small freight train shuttling in the station platforms and sidings at Winchcombe station by the two guest well tanks, Kerr Stuart no.3063 Willy the well tank & E Borrows no.48 The King.
Locomotive roster:
Resident locos:
GWR 28xx 2807
GWR 2884 3850
GWR 68xx Grange class 6880 Bettonn Grange
GWR Modified Hall 7903 Formarke Hall
SR Merchant Navy 35006 Peninsular & Oriental S. N. Co.
Guest engines:
Kerr Stuart 0-4-0WT no.3063 Willy (courtesy of the Flour Mill)
E Borrows 0-4-0WT no.48 The King (courtesy of the Ribble Steam Railway)
Andrew Barclay Austerity 0-6-0ST no.15 Earl David (courtesy of Railway Support Services)
GWR 57xx 7714 (courtesy of the Severn Valley Railway)
BR Standard 4mt 75069 (courtesy of the Severn Valley Railway)
SECR O1 no.65 (Courtesy of the Bluebell Railway)
